Christmas Cranberry Orange Cookies: An Incredible Ultimate Recipe

Ingredients

– 2 cups all-purpose flour
– 1 cup granulated sugar
– 1 teaspoon baking soda
– ½ teaspoon salt
– 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
– 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
– 1 large egg
– 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
– Zest of 1 large orange
– 1 cup fresh or dried cranberries, chopped
– Optional: ½ cup chopped walnuts or pecans

Instructions

Getting started on your delicious Christmas Cranberry Orange Cookies is straightforward if you follow these easy steps:

1. Preheat the Oven: Set your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
2.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, salt, and ground cinnamon.
3. Cream Butter and Sugar: In a large mixing bowl, use an electric mixer to cream the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
4. Add Egg and Vanilla: Mix in the egg and vanilla extract, blending well to incorporate.
5. Incorporate Orange Zest: Gently fold in the orange zest to the mixture.
6. Combine Mixtures: Gradually add the flour mixture to the butter mixture, mixing until just combined.
7. Fold in Cranberries: Gently fold in the chopped cranberries and nuts if using.
8. Scoop Out Cookies: Use a cookie scoop or tablespoon to drop dough onto the prepared baking sheet, leaving enough space between each.
9. Bake: Place in the preheated oven and bake for 12-15 minutes or until the edges are lightly golden.
10. Cool: Remove cookies from the oven, letting them cool on the baking sheet for 5-10 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ack.
